So what happened with him? How did he go from winning the award for best interior lineman in college football and a first round draft pick to where he is now?


canadianduke1980

The raiders cut him in Aug of 2022, a year after drafting him in the first round. He was atrocious. Could not pass block. At all. And took a LOT of penalties, iirc. Bears signed him the next day. I think he made 53 man there but didn’t play much. Bears released him. I’m not sure what he did in 2023 with the Browns. Practice squad maybe. This is a camp body, and a look and see. That is all. He won’t make the team unless he beats out some guys that have played okay-ish for us
